Only a handful of Navajo silversmiths can get this amazing revival look. It is a combination of things that gets this result. First, you have classic pieces of American turquoise with that right cut. These pieces of Stone Cabin Turquoise show off a deep green color with a flowing copper colored matrix. All three Nevada rocks are sitting on a heavy piece of silver, the next important attribute to getting this great look. Third, Arland has stamps that capture the look of the era he is trying to replicate. Last, everything is right where it is supposed to be and the work is clean, no mistakes. Having the skills and then a great eye for design is possessed by the lucky few.
